Exercise is the fabulous way to stay fit, boost up mental capabilities, maintain health and lose excess body weight. Although it takes a bit of energy and time to exercise daily, it offers benefits that far surpass the efforts you put. Muscles get weaker and flabbier with a sedentary lifestyle. To help the heart and lungs function properly, exercising on regular basis is a must. Inactivity is as risky as smoking since it makes the joints rigid, stiff and more prone to injuries. Daily exercise helps in strengthening of heart muscles. It helps maintain desired cholesterol levels. Daily physical activity reduces one’s chances of stroke and the risk of heart disease. Daily physical activity is the key to a long life! Regular exercise helps in the prevention of obesity, which is one of the important factors responsible for many severe diseases. Exercise helps in reducing the risk of diabetes, blood pressure and heart diseases. Research has shown that people engaging in a daily physical activity live longer than those who do not exercise at all. Regular exercise reverses the natural decline in the metabolism that sets in after the age of thirty. Those who exercise regularly are found to remain more productive and energetic during the day. Increased energy levels help remain active during the day.

Namita is from the state of Kerala. She has come to Dubai to serve as a governess for the only child of the Nairs. The Nairs are nice and gentle and Namita has no cause to complain. One day she overhears something that makes her jittery. Mr. Nair is not employed in an American company as she has been told. The nature of his business is illegal. She is shocked and wants to go back to her hometown to her own people.

Gopal is from a very poor family. His family owns a very small piece of land that can hardly meet their food requirement. One day, Gopal gets a nice offer to work in the Emirates with a construction contractor. In order to meet the expenses of traveling, the family decides to sell their own land and send Gopal to the foreign country, to make money. On arrival, the contractor confiscates Gopal's passport and gives him a small place to live in with ten others like him. Gopal has little idea what he must do.
